Ugandan vs Pakistani Divorced or Separated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 94,013,976 people shows a mild negative correlation between the proportion of Ugandans and percentage of population currently divorced or separated in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.350 and weighted average of 11.8%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 335,267,594 people shows a slight negative correlation between the proportion of Pakistanis and percentage of population currently divorced or separated in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.078 and weighted average of 11.9%, a difference of 1.0%.
